Breaking Is Coming to the Olympics
Breaking (霹雳舞) is a lively street dance born in New York during the 1970s. It will be a new official sport of the 2024 Paris Olympics. The best B-boys and B-girls will show their great skills and creativity in one-on-one battles (对决), where each dancer has 60 seconds to impress the judges with their fast steps, hard poses and crazy spins (旋转). So you can expect the most exciting performances at the Olympics this summer.

On my first round-the-world trip in 2006, I planned everything out in advance. I knew where I was going, staying for how long, and how I would get there. And then half-way through I ditched the plan and went with the flow (随大流). Over the years, how I plan my travel has changed. Now, I’m a last-minute planner and seldom travel with any plan.
Traveling without a plan gives you great flexibility (灵活性). Since nothing is booked far in advance, you can turn to something different when you change your mind or something better comes along. I changed my plans to meet a friend on an island in Thailand and stayed for a month. I wouldn’t have had that experience if I had kept to my planned schedule.
“ ★ ” — they overplan their trips. Their whole journey is scheduled. Two days here, three days there. I understand why people do that. When time is short, you want to see as much as possible. You don’t want to waste a single second.
Actually, it is better to slow down your pace. Spending more time in one place allows you to get a better feel for the rhythm of life. You can visit at a more relaxed pace, see more than just the attractions, and open up your schedule to the happy accidents of travel.
When I first made my travel plan, I tried to include everything in it. Then I realized it was unrealistic, and reviewed my plan. I came up with a list of one or two things I want to see each day and spaced everything out. It’s an important lesson to learn. I think the best trip plan is to work out the general path you want to take, book the first few nights of your trip, and let your travels unfold from there. This way you are never locked into a certain place if your feelings change.

①“I killed the wrong goose (鹅),” a man complained in his letter about the Xinhua Dictionary. It was the 1970s. The man wanted to kill a male goose. He didn’t know the difference between male and female goose, so he turned to the dictionary for help. It read, “The male geese have a yellow bump on their head.”
②The man chose a goose that matched the description. But when he opened its stomach, many eggs poured out, and the man was angry.
③The dictionary wasn’t totally wrong. However, it didn’t make it clear that all geese have a yellow bump on their head. Males have just bigger ones. The dictionary’s editors corrected it in the next edition (版本).
④Since its birth in 1953, the Xinhua Dictionary has been used as an encyclopedia (百科全书) by people across China. More than 600 million copies have been sold.
⑤In 1949, about 80 percent of China’s population was uneducated. Xinhua Dictionary succeeded in opening up knowledge to millions of Chinese people. “I had no education when I was little. The dictionary helped me get into high school. “ Said a woman in her 50s.
⑥Over the past 50 years, the dictionary has been improved in each edition. “鲟”was once explained as”can be eaten”. Later editions made it clear that it was “an animal in danger”. The meaning of “豹”is no longer “wild animals whose fur can be made into clothes”. New editions have included many new meanings. The character “晒” (to dry something under the sun) , for example, now has a second meaning: to share. Popular expressions like “初心”have also been added to dictionary.
⑦In a way, Xinhua hasn’t just explained words; it has shaped the way Chinese people think. According to an article in Southern Weekly, “When children write about a spring outing, the sky is always ‘cloudless for ten thousand miles’. They will always ‘sing and dance’ on the way. “ “Both sentences, “ the editor added, “ are from examples in the Xinhua Dictionary.”
